Enhanced Surface Finish
One of the primary advantages of using peel ply fabric is its ability to significantly improve the surface finish of composite parts. When applied during the manufacturing process, the peel ply fabric acts as a sacrificial layer that comes into direct contact with the composite material. As the resin cures, the fabric leaves behind a clean, uniform, and textured surface on the composite part. This surface finish is ideal for bonding, painting, or applying additional layers of composite material, as it provides an excellent mechanical key for adhesion.

Improved Bonding Strength
Peel ply fabric plays a crucial role in enhancing the bonding strength between composite layers or between composite materials and other substrates. The textured surface left behind by the peel ply fabric provides a larger surface area for the adhesive to bond to, increasing the mechanical interlock between the layers. This results in a stronger and more durable bond that can withstand higher loads and stresses.
In addition to improving the mechanical bond, peel ply fabric also helps to remove any contaminants or release agents from the surface of the composite part, ensuring a clean and pristine bonding surface. This is especially important when using high-performance adhesives, as even small amounts of contaminants can significantly reduce the bonding strength.
Ease of Handling and Installation
Peel ply fabric is incredibly easy to handle and install, making it a popular choice among composites manufacturers. The fabric is typically available in rolls or sheets, which can be easily cut to the desired size and shape using standard cutting tools. It can be applied to the composite part using a variety of methods, including hand lay-up, vacuum bagging, or resin infusion.
When using vacuum bagging, peel ply fabric is placed directly on top of the composite material before applying the vacuum bag. The fabric conforms to the shape of the part, ensuring a tight and uniform fit. During the curing process, the vacuum pressure helps to remove any air bubbles or excess resin from the composite part, resulting in a high-quality finish.
